Sample preparation
Crystal | Density Matthews: 2.38 Å3/Da / Density % sol: 48.41 % |
---|---|
Crystal grow | Temperature: 277 K / Method: vapor diffusion, hanging drop / pH: 8.5 Details: 100 mM Bis- Tris pH, 200 mM Na/K Tartrate; 11% PEG 3350, pH 8.5, VAPOR DIFFUSION, HANGING DROP, temperature 277K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: ![]() ![]() ![]() |
Detector | Type: DECTRIS PILATUS 6M / Detector: PIXEL / Date: Feb 14, 2011 |
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.9778 Å / Relative weight: 1 |
Reflection | Resolution: 1.8→19.1 Å / Num. all: 30223 / Num. obs: 30175 / % possible obs: 99.9 % / Observed criterion σ(F): -3 / Observed criterion σ(I): -3 |
Reflection shell | Resolution: 1.8→1.87 Å / % possible all: 100 |
